There was allowed 100 g (1.0 mmol) of trimethylsilyl ethene to react with 127 g (1.1 mol) of methyldichlorosilane in a 500-ml flask equipped with a dropping funnel, reflux condenser, stirrer and nitrogen gas introducing tube, by steps of placing 20 ml of a mixture of trimethylsilyl ethene and methyldichlorosilane and 0.0051 g (0.01 mmol) of chloroplatinic acid in the flask, adding dropwise the remaining mixture of trimethylsilyl ethene and methyldichlorosilane thereto over a period of 4 hours while stirring the reaction mixture, and continuing the stirring for another 1 hour to complete the reaction. Subsequently, 200 ml of hexane was added to the reaction mixture, and the catalyst precipitated was filtered off. The filtrate was condensed and vaccum-distlled. 145 g (yield: 75%) of (2-trimethylsilylethyl)methyldichlorosilane was obtained.
